 With true love comes happiness <3 <3 <3 Always believe in your self and always do things expecting nothing and with an open heart , be a giver and the universe will give back to you in ways you could not even imagine so <3 <3 <3 Friendly reminder all you see here is pure research and for educational purposes only <3 <3 <3 Growers Love To you All <3 <3 <3 Strain info : About Auto Purple OG Punch cannabis seeds To create Auto Purple OG Punch we crossed our feminized Purple Punch with an autoflower OG Kush. The original Purple Punch is a cross between Larry OG and Grandaddy Purple, illustrious and stable indica dominant THC-rich heavyweights! The total grow cycle from autoflower seed to harvest is a short 9 weeks. You will be rewarded with a large yield of sticky resinous buds, up to 600g/m2 indoors. If you’re looking to grow a high quality indica auto made with cannabis cup winning genetics you will love Auto Purple OG Punch. THC content is always up-to/around 20%. Auto Purple OG Punch effects are intense, euphoric and relaxed. She also contains around 1% CDB which contributes to the very smooth, chilled smoke. Expect a mouthwatering blend of sweet tasting candy, dark fruit and hints of spice. A real connoisseur cocktail with powerful effects! She normally reaches around 1m tall. But in optimized conditions with LED grow lights you can see occasional monster plants up to 2m tall with XXL yields. Auto Purple OG Punch is easy, potent and heavy yielding indoors. She also delivers well outdoors - such as the balcony or garden. Auto Purple OG Punch is a perfect, powerful strain for a quiet relaxed day. The calming indica body effect is very satisfying and de-stressing

This grow started on October 20, and today is December 26, which puts the plants into Week 9 of the overall cycle. The last defoliation and pruning was done around December 16. After that, I made a conscious decision to stop cutting and stressing the plants. Earlier in veg I definitely over-stressed them — too much training, too many interventions. In hindsight, that slowed things down instead of helping. From this point on, the goal was to let the plants recover, grow freely, and build momentum in order to reach the flowering stage as smoothly and quickly as possible. Lesson learned for future grows: less stress fewer unnecessary cuts more patience Sometimes the hardest part is not touching the plants at all, especially when your hands are itching to train and optimize everything. Week 9 is about recovery, structure, and preparation for flower. Next week marks the start of flowering.

Day 36- LST adjustments. Each lady received almost a full gallon of water each. I also dosed each gallon with 4ml cal mag plus. I guess I would consider this week 1 of flowering. Next watering I'll introduce bloom nutrients. They getting hairy! I feel like I'm also seeing some improvement in each plant after Foliar Spray, so I'm hoping after this watering they'll perk up and not have more sick leaves to look at. Day 37- I did a few LST adjustments on the smaller plants. "Blue Marker" is getting pretty stiff so I'm afraid to tie her down and have only been tucking leaves. Probably just going to try to keep her spread out as much as I can do. No more LST for her. Day 38- They've been drinking alot of water and are thirsty! Now normally I water once a week, but they may need it before their next water time. Lowered the lights to 18" above canopy. Will see if I get any canoes or not when I get back home tomorrow evening. It smells good when I open the tent as well 👌. Only uphill from here on! Day 39- Ladies didn't show any light stress to me lowering them down to 18". Blue Marker looks like she needs to be watered. The other two are still heavy. Probably be watering blue marker tomorrow evening and starting bloom nutrients. Day 40- Watered Blue Marker today with 4ml/gal CalMag+ and 2tsp/gallon of Old Age Bloom. Will be watering Yellow Marker tomorrow with the same ratio. The runt still probably has a few more days until she's ready for a drink. Day 41- Watered Yellow Marker with 4ml/gal CalMag+ and 2tsp/gal of Old Age Bloom. Will be watering the runt tomorrow. Went ahead and snapped a lower bud site on the runt. Didn't look promising enough to warrant keeping it. As you can see in the picture, most of the leaves were shriveled up on it anyways. I also tucked fan leaves on all plants and measured Blue Marker (17.5in) tall and Yellow Marker is about 1ft tall. Day 42- Watered "Runt" with 4ml/gal CalMag+ and 2 tsp/gal of Old Age Bloom. All plants new growth looks better and doesn't look like it's traveling up plant. More and more bud sites are popping up. Yellow Marker looks farther along than Blue Marker. End of week 6!
